Ask for Client References

Requesting client references serves as an effective way to gauge a kitchen contractor‘s credibility and previous work quality. Speaking directly with past clients allows potential remodelers to uncover firsthand experiences, insights, and any challenges faced during the remodeling process. Understanding preferences expressed by previous clients can significantly influence the selection decision.
References can provide information about the kitchen contractor‘s reliability, professionalism, and ability to meet deadlines. Clients should ask detailed questions, such as whether the contractor maintained communication throughout the project or adhered to the budget. Obtaining the contractor‘s email address may streamline follow-up discussions with references for a deeper understanding of their experiences.

Finalize Contractor Selection Using Bid Requests

Requesting bids from selected kitchen renovation contractors is a vital step in finalizing the contractor selection process. Each bid should detail the scope of work, including the materials used, such as quartz countertops and the installation of a cooktop. This information helps clients evaluate the financial implications and the overall complexity of their kitchen remodeling project.
During the review of the bids, clients must scrutinize the breakdown of costs to ensure transparency. This includes clarifying any potential liens and understanding how each contractor addresses financial elements. Clear documentation provides peace of mind, allowing clients to make informed decisions about their chosen contractor based on both cost-effectiveness and quality of services offered.
